在使用第三方库的类之前编写javadoc注释时,用于记录可以下载的第三方库名称,版本和Web地址的标准/官方方式是什么?是应该在说明中提到还是在块标签中使用(使用@see或自定义标签)?
取决于你想要完成的事情.
版本和下载链接应位于依赖关系管理工具的配置文件中(例如maven).这样,文档永远不会过时,并且在每个碰巧使用该特定API的类中都不会重复.
要发现哪些类使用哪个API,导入语句可以很好地工作(是的,可以通过使用限定的类名绕过import语句,但很少有人这样做,因为这使得源代码很难阅读).或者,只需从类路径中删除库,并查看编译错误发生的位置.
我建议不要在javadoc中记录这个,因为你的类的调用者应该不知道它的实现.也就是说,我认为API曾经是调用者不应该知道的实现细节 - 调用者不应该知道的不应该与他必须知道的东西混在一起.
| 归档时间: |
|
| 查看次数: |
66 次 |
| 最近记录: |